We are a lab of passionate marine ecologists at CMSI UNSW, conducting solutions-based research on human stressors in estuarine and coastal ecosystems.
New publication from our lab on the impacts of artificial light at night and warming on sea urchin grazing rates and gonad index!

Trial habitat module deployments this week in Sydney Harbour, for an experiment looking at the interactive effects of artificial light pollution and habitat complexity on biodiversity, led by PhD student Lena Holtmanns, supervised by Mariana Mayer Pinto and Alistair Poore, at UNSW.

Hi everyone! We are the SEACS lab at UNSW, investigating Solutions for Estuarine And Coastal Stressors. Headed by Dr. Mariana Mayer Pinto, we study a diverse range of human impacts, including artificial structures, light pollution and climate change in coastal ecosystems 😊🌱✹🐚💡
